"Bombay" (1995): A Symbiotic Love Story Masterpiece of Cinema and Music Amidst Turmoil.

Writer & Director: Mani Ratnam

Cast: Arvind Swamy, Manisha Koirala, Nassar 

Cinematography: Rajiv Menon

Music: AR Rahman

Bombay (1995), directed by Mani Ratnam, is a love story of Shekhar, a Hindu boy, and Shaila, a Muslim girl, who elope to Bombay amidst societal disapproval. Raising twin sons, their world shatters during the 1993 Bombay riots, as communal tensions threaten their family. Arvind Swamy and Manisha Koirala deliver nuanced performances, enhanced by A.R. Rahman’s evocative music, notably the iconic "Bombay Theme." A powerful film, Bombay explores love, resilience, and hope amidst the devastating reality of religious violence.
